BETHLEHEM, Sunday, November 22, 2020 (WAFA) – Fanatic Israeli settlers assaulted today a Palestinian elderly and his son in the hamlet of Shushahla, to the south of the city of Bethlehem in the occupied West Bank, according to a local source.
Muhannad Salah, a local resident, said he was grazing livestock with his elderly father when armed Israeli settlers from the illegal Israeli settlement of Eliazar threw rocks at them in an attempt to force them out of their land. He said local residents were able to fend off the attack.
Salah pointed out that Israeli occupation forces and settlers repeatedly target the hamlet aiming to empty it of its few residents for the benefit of the colonial Israeli settlement enterprise.
Meanwhile, Israeli settlers from the illegal Israeli settlement of Susya assaulted a number of Palestinians as they were trying to kick settlers out of their lands, in the village of Susya, in the southern West Bank district of Hebron.
